Global gas & LNG weekly summary: 16 Mar 2023
Report summary
TTF’s front-month contract settled at $13.2 on Wednesday, relatively flat to last week, as demand continued to drop. We continue to think that the market will likely overshoot to the downside before seeing demand emerge in a big way, as traders watch to see if low prices are here to stay. TTF continues to sit in the coal-to-gas switching range indicating we should see an increase in price sensitive demand in the coming weeks. We also are seeing LNG prices approach the oil parity price for the first time since 2021.
